    An excerpt from Chapter Thirteen, Confidentiality: Respect It and Protect It

    Engaged Ambassadors care about their students and their coworkers. They treat confidential information in the same manner that they would want such information handled if it was about their own family. Engaged Ambassadors “respect and protect” all information they have access to at work.
